Crystal Lake Bed and Breakfast in Barton, VT offers a charming and cozy retreat for guests seeking a peaceful getaway in the heart of nature.
With comfortable accommodations and a warm, welcoming atmosphere, this establishment provides a relaxing setting for visitors to unwind and enjoy the beauty of the surrounding area.
Generated from their business information